Manchester United makes final decision on Mason Greenwood

Manchester United have commenced negotiations with Lazio regarding the transfer of Mason Greenwood, according to a report by The Daily Mail. The move follows Greenwood’s loan spell at Getafe last season after an internal investigation by Manchester United into his conduct.

Greenwood, 22, was arrested in January 2022 following allegations related to material published on social media. The charges, which included attempted rape and assault, were dropped on February 2, 2023. Despite this, Manchester United decided against reintegrating him into their first-team squad after an end-of-season review.

During his time at Getafe, Greenwood made a significant impact, scoring 10 goals in 36 appearances across all competitions. With his future at Old Trafford now in question, the Red Devils are entertaining offers for the forward, and Lazio have expressed a keen interest.

The Italian side, who finished seventh in Serie A last season, have opened talks with Manchester United over a potential £30 million deal for Greenwood. This figure could increase based on performance-related add-ons. Lazio had previously shown interest in Greenwood before Getafe secured his loan move last season.

Lazio believe they can offer Greenwood a platform to continue his rehabilitation and build on the progress he made in Spain. The Rome-based club is confident that their project represents the best opportunity for Greenwood to further his career, despite competition from domestic rivals Juventus and Napoli, as well as teams from Spain, Germany, and Portugal.

As talks progress positively, Manchester United are preparing for additional offers from other clubs. Greenwood’s next move will be closely watched as he seeks to rebuild his career following his time at Getafe.
